What Are Online Slot Games?
Online slot games are digital versions of traditional slot machines. Instead of visiting a physical casino, players can access digital reels through an online platform where such gambling is legal and available.
The basic concept is straightforward. A player chooses a wager and spins the reels. The symbols that appear are determined by the game’s random-number system. If the resulting combination matches one of the winning patterns listed in the game’s paytable, the player receives the corresponding payout.
Although the basic idea is simple, modern online slots can be surprisingly sophisticated.

How Does an Online Slot Work?
Most modern online slots rely on a random number generator (RNG). The RNG produces outcomes according to the game’s programming, making individual spins unpredictable.
A typical game includes reels containing different symbols. Depending on the design, players may need matching symbols across paylines, winning ways, or other combinations to produce a payout.
Before starting a game, it is important to read its paytable. The paytable usually explains the value of symbols, available features, potential winning combinations, and other rules.
Different Types of Online Slots
Online slots are not all the same. Understanding the main categories can help beginners identify the type of game they prefer.
Classic Slots
Classic slots are designed around the traditional casino-machine format. They often have three reels and straightforward gameplay, making them suitable for players who prefer simplicity.
Video Slots
Video slots are generally more feature-rich. They can include multiple reels, numerous paylines, animated graphics, bonus rounds, wild symbols, scatters, and other mechanics.
Progressive Jackpot Slots
Progressive jackpot games can offer potentially large prizes because the jackpot may increase as qualifying play contributes to a shared prize pool. However, the chance of hitting a major jackpot is typically very small, and the specific rules vary between games.
Mobile Slots
Mobile slots are designed for smartphones and tablets. Responsive interfaces and simplified controls allow players to interact with games on smaller screens.
Important Slot Features
Modern slots often contain special features that make gameplay more varied.
Wild symbols can sometimes substitute for other symbols to help form winning combinations. Scatter symbols may activate free-spin rounds or other bonuses. Some games also include multipliers, expanding symbols, bonus games, cascading reels, or special reel configurations.
These features can make a game more entertaining, but they do not eliminate the element of chance.
Understanding RTP and Volatility
Two terms frequently appear when discussing online slots: RTP and volatility.
RTP, or return to player, is a theoretical percentage calculated over a very large number of plays. For example, a game with a stated RTP of 96% is mathematically designed to return an average of $96 for every $100 wagered over an extremely large sample of play. It does not mean that an individual player will receive $96 back after wagering $100.
Volatility describes how frequently and how substantially a game tends to pay. Lower-volatility games may have smaller wins occurring more regularly, while higher-volatility games can have less frequent but potentially larger wins.
Neither RTP nor volatility can predict the result of a particular spin.
Is There a Strategy for Winning at Slots?
Because online slots are games of chance, there is no betting strategy that can guarantee a profit or predict the next winning spin.
Claims that a particular machine is “due” for a jackpot or that changing betting patterns can control the RNG should be treated skeptically. Previous spins do not make a future spin more likely to produce a particular result.
A better approach is to understand the game’s rules and establish spending limits before playing.
Responsible Online Slot Gaming
The most important part of online gambling is maintaining control over spending and time.
Players should only gamble with money they can afford to lose and should never treat gambling as a reliable source of income. Setting a predetermined budget can help prevent impulsive decisions.
It is also important to avoid chasing losses. Increasing wagers simply because previous spins have resulted in losses can quickly turn recreational gaming into a financial problem.
Anyone who feels that gambling is becoming difficult to control should consider taking a break and seeking support from an appropriate gambling-help organization.
